Visualizzazione dei risultati da 1 a 8 su 8
  1. #1

    Access Report Con Scelta

    Ok e' da tanto che non lo uso..


    io ho una tabella cosi definita

    IDmodello 1 2
    data 25/02/08 26/02/08
    lavoratore Pippo Baudo PLUTO
    ufficio Casa Via Davato
    motivazione Sta Male Sta Bene
    note ha la febbre E' sveglio
    modello AC41 P43


    ora vorrei una maschera che a secondo di che tipo di modello scelgono stampa un report.
    vorrei permettere la scelta del modello da stampare secondo una maschera con una "Casella Combinata" (combo). E Premendo stampa lui genera il report e stampa.

    e' una cosa semplicissima che non usando piu access ora mi ritrovo in difficolta'...AIUUTOOO

  2. #2

    hELP

    mado aiuto...

  3. #3
    Utente di HTML.it L'avatar di Rickycast
    Registrato dal
    Apr 2007
    residenza
    CHIERI (TO)
    Messaggi
    263
    Devi creare una Maschera con una "Casella Combinata" la cui origine dei dati è la tua Tabella.
    Costruisci due Report (Report1 e Report2) uno per ogni visualizzazione.
    Nelle Proprietà/Dati della Casella Combinata definisci come "Colonna Associata" quella di tuo interesse, magari l'ID.
    Nelle Proprietà/Evento/su Click della Casella Combinata scrivi il Codice:

    Private Sub CasellaCombinata_Click()
    If CasellaCombinata = (il valore dell'ID della prima Riga) Then
    DoCmd.OpenReport ("Report1",,,)
    Else
    DoCmd.OpenReport ("Report2",,,)
    End if
    End Sub

    Ci sono anche sistemi più raffinati, ma se non hai più dimestichezza con Access, prova con questo.

  4. #4
    io ho provato ma non sono riuscito..

    ma tramite i criteri?cioe' io faccio apro la query e inserisco il tipo di query.

    vorrei fare piu una ricerca una sorta di dammi tutti quelli con..

    ok?

    GRAZIE!

  5. #5
    Moderatore di Programmazione L'avatar di LeleFT
    Registrato dal
    Jun 2003
    Messaggi
    17,327

    Moderazione

    Visto che Access utilizza VBA e visto che VBA è similabile a Visual Basic, sposto su VisualBasic e .NET Framework.

    Ciao.
    "Perchè spendere anche solo 5 dollari per un S.O., quando posso averne uno gratis e spendere quei 5 dollari per 5 bottiglie di birra?" [Jon "maddog" Hall]
    Fatti non foste a viver come bruti, ma per seguir virtute e canoscenza

  6. #6
    Utente di HTML.it L'avatar di Rickycast
    Registrato dal
    Apr 2007
    residenza
    CHIERI (TO)
    Messaggi
    263
    Fammi capire:

    1 - hai una tabella con N campi e M righe.
    2 - ti serve una maschera nella quale visualizzare il contenuto della tabella
    3 - ti serve inoltre che kliccando su una delle righe visualizzate venga stampato il Report specifico per quella riga.

    Se è così, non c'è bisogno di nessuna query, basta quello che ti ho già scritto, a meno che tu non abbia un numero di Reports maggiore di due. La sola cosa che cambia in questo caso è che devi aumentare gli "If" dell'espressione condizionale ed ovviamente creare un numero identico di Reports.

  7. #7
    asp illustro meglio

    Id Modello DataCompilazione Lavoratore UfficioCompetenza
    62 07/03/2008 ggg DSC/DRU
    63 07/03/2008 pippo ANTONIO
    64 07/03/2008 simplicio REMO
    65 07/03/2008 carlo DSIS
    66 07/03/2008 mimmo CSI
    67 07/03/2008 tauro Parcoauto

    io vorrei semplicemente una maschera che selezionando i tipi di uffici ti stampi un report con

    Id Modello DataCompilazione Lavoratore UfficioCompetenza
    62 07/03/2008 ggg DSC/DRU


    la selezione penso che sia piu semplice con una casella combinata in una maschera.

    se puoi mi spieghi come fare?casomai postando un esempio di db?ti sono ETERNAMENTE GRADO!

  8. #8
    Utente di HTML.it L'avatar di Rickycast
    Registrato dal
    Apr 2007
    residenza
    CHIERI (TO)
    Messaggi
    263
    Postami il tuo indirzzo mail.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.